DFS Captain / MVP Picks
Kawhi Leonard, LAC
(DK CPT - $15,600, UTIL - $10,400 / FD CPT - $18,900, UTIL - $12,600)
In a very competitive game against the Rockets last time out, Kawhi Leonard played a season-high 41 minutes and looked fantastic on both ends. He topped 50 FP to boot, and a matchup against the Grizzlies is far superior to the Rockets on. Leonard has surpassed James Harden as the team leader on the FP/min front and is not listed on the injury report as Harden is. We’re talking about a guy with a 31% USG rate, and as we just saw, 40-minute upside to boot.
James Harden, LAC
(DK CPT - $16,200, UTIL - $10,800 / FD CPT - $20,400, UTIL - $13,600)
We’ll see if James Harden plays because as soon as you start talking about calf injuries these days, it’s very much up in the air. But, if he does, Harden’s a great play. He’s posted a 31% USG and has averaged 1.3 FP/min as well. It’s a great pace-up spot for James Harden and the Clippers, too.
Ja Morant, MEM
(DK CPT - $15,000, UTIL - $10,000 / FD CPT - $17,700, UTIL - $11,800)
In Ja Morant’s return, he posted a 40.9% USG and put up 43.5 DKP and 39.8 FDP. He also had 14 potential assists to boot. He played 25 minutes and definitely could get a bump up somewhere near 30. Without Zach Edey this year, Morant has a 32.7% USG and 1.17 FP/min this year.
Santi Aldama, MEM
(DK CPT - $11,400, UTIL - $7,600 / FD CPT - $14,100, UTIL - $9,400)
I wonder if the Grizzlies are going to continue to roll out their Santi Aldama / Jaren Jackson, or if they will use Jock Landale in their starting lineup because Ivica Zubac is opposing them. Either way, Aldama should get plenty of minutes as he played 35 in the team’s first game without Edey. This year, without Edey, Aldama has a 20.6% USG and is averaging 1.1 FP/min.Â
Ivica Zubac, MEM
(DK CPT - $14,100, UTIL - $9,400 / FD CPT - $16,500, UTIL - $11,000)
There’s actually a TON to like about Ivica Zubac here, and it’s possible he goes nuclear here. If you look at the Memphis Grizzlies' numbers without Zach Edey earlier in the year, it makes me love Zubac. They were 24th in DRtg from the start of the year to November 12th, a span in which Edey missed, and were also 20th in rebounding. Zubac has been fantastic outside of one game as he’s scored 30-plus DKP in 17 of his last 18 games. It came against the Grizzlies, who had Edey. Coincidence? I think not.

DFS Utility Picks
Cedric Coward, MEM
(DK CPT - $11,500, UTIL - $7,000 / FD CPT - $11,400, UTIL - $7,600)
After a little bit of a lull, Cedric Coward has looked really good in two of his last three games as he’s posted 40-plus FP in those two. He’s sitting at a near 20% USG and is at 1.04 FP/min this year without Zach Edey. His minutes limit has been lifted, and he is consistently sitting around 30 minutes per game.
Jock Landale, MEM
(DK CPT - $7,800, UTIL - $5,200 / FD CPT - $7,800, UTIL - $5,200)
Life without Zach Edey includes more Jock Landale for the Grizzlies, and he’s a pretty good player. He’s a .99 FP/min player without Edey this year, too. Landale played 27 minutes despite coming off the bench, and we should see him play mid-to-high 20s minutes as long as Edey is out.
Cam Spencer, MEM
(DK CPT - $8,700, UTIL - $5,800 / FD CPT - $10,200, UTIL - $6,800)
Let’s face it; Cam Spencer isn’t going to continue to shoot this way forever, but man, he can’t miss at all right now. He’s up to 50% from three-point territory this year, and the Clippers allow the fifth-most threes per game while allowing the highest opponent field goal percentage from deep. Spencer’s been over 30 DKP in four straight games and has been over 20 in 11 straight. Having a nice floor is a good final piece in your showdown lineups.
